by RobertflUem » Sat Mar 07, 2026 12:54 pm
aljazeeranewstoday.com - Stay on top of latest News developments with Al Jazeera News Today fact-based news.
https://www.aljazeeranewstoday.com
aljazeeranewstoday.com - Stay on top of latest News developments with Al Jazeera News Today fact-based news.
https://www.aljazeeranewstoday.com